Hey there! I had something similar happen in my Fiesta, though I can't remember if the year was the same. The low brake fluid and weird pedal feel could mean a few things, but the first thing that comes to my mind is worn brake pads. As they wear down, the pistons in the calipers need to extend further, which uses more brake fluid, thus lowering the level in the reservoir. Do you know the age of your brakes?
